How to backup all of my configured queries in Splunk DB Connect?

Hi, I have to take backup of my all configured queries in DBconnect. Please suggest how could i do that ?

What is file and location of file where its getting stored ?

All of your configured DBConnect queries are stored in the inputs.conf. Depending on how, and where, you created these, they will be in

$splunk_home/etc/apps/dbx/local/inputs.conf

If you have created these specifically in different APP space, you will need to check there.

Additionally, btool is your friend.

$splunk_home/bin/splunk btool inputs list --debug

Search that for your db queries, and it will tell you which file it is stored in.
